What is a reverse engineer?

A reverse engineer is a professional who analyzes hardware or software systems to understand their design, functionality, and operation. They often work to identify vulnerabilities, recreate proprietary technologies, or ensure compatibility with other systems. Reverse engineers use specialized tools and techniques to deconstruct and study products, which is especially common in cybersecurity, software development, and electronics. Their work helps improve security, troubleshoot issues, and sometimes develop new innovations based on existing products.

What are the key skills and qualifications needed to thrive as a reverse engineer, and why are they important?

To thrive as a Reverse Engineer, you need expertise in computer programming, software debugging, and a solid understanding of operating systems and low-level software architecture, often backed by a degree in computer science or a related field. Familiarity with tools like IDA Pro, Ghidra, OllyDbg, and knowledge of assembly languages are commonly required, with certifications such as CEH or OSCP adding value. Attention to detail, strong problem-solving abilities, and perseverance are crucial soft skills for analyzing complex systems and uncovering hidden functionalities. These skills ensure accurate, efficient analysis of software for security assessments, malware analysis, and intellectual property protection.

What are some common challenges faced by reverse engineers when working on proprietary software or hardware?

Reverse engineers often encounter challenges such as obfuscated code, lack of documentation, and anti-tamper mechanisms designed to prevent analysis. Working with proprietary systems can require extensive problem-solving and persistence to understand undocumented protocols or custom algorithms. Collaboration with security analysts and developers is common, especially when identifying vulnerabilities or developing interoperability solutions. Staying up-to-date with the latest tools and techniques is crucial, as software protections continually evolve.

Role: Android Reverse Engineer

Location: This is a Hybrid position in Austin, TX, Bothell, WA and San Jose, CA. You must reside in one of these (3) three cities.

Duration: 12 month

This position is for an Android Malware Reverse Engineer on a threat research team. The primary goal is to conduct detailed static and dynamic analysis on malicious Android applications and SDKs to understand their behavior, classify them into malware families, and develop scalable detection signatures (e.g., Yara) to protect users.

Required Skills

  • 3+ years in Android Reverse Engineering (RE) and analysis of malicious applications or SDKs.
  • Hands-on experience with RE tools: Jadx, Ghidra, Frida, IDA Pro, Burp.
  • Strong proficiency in Static and Dynamic Analysis Techniques.
  • Knowledge of mobile software languages: Java, Kotlin, JavaScript, Flutter.
  • Experience with ELF (Native Binaries) reverse engineering.
  • Strong understanding of Android Fundamentals, activity lifecycles, AOSP, and API usage.
  • Ability to read, comprehend, and analyze source code.
  • Experience with Query languages (SQL).

Preferred Skills

  • Experience with Vulnerability Analysis or security code review.
  • Android Software Development Experience.
  • Familiarity with Google Ads or Content Moderation.
  • Participation in a Capture the Flag (CTF) for Mobile software.
  • Pentesting, Blue Team, and/or Red Team experience.
